About Bhadayni

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Bhadayni village is 200319. Bhadayni village is located in Shahganj tehsil of Jaunpur district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 18km away from sub-district headquarter Shahganj (tehsildar office) and 28km away from district headquarter Jaunpur. As per 2009 stats, Barangi is the gram panchayat of Bhadayni village.

The total geographical area of village is 25.66 hectares. Bhadayni has a total population of 652 peoples, out of which male population is 333 while female population is 319. Literacy rate of bhadayni village is 48.31% out of which 54.95% males and 41.38% females are literate. There are about 95 houses in bhadayni village.

As per 2019 stats, Bhadayni village comes under Jaunpur assembly & parliamentary constituency. Shahganj is nearest town to bhadayni for all major economic activities, which is approximately 18km away.
